On 10/13/2017 01:39 PM, Tony Krowiak wrote: > Implements an ioctl to configure the adapters, usage domains > and control domains to which a KVM guest will be granted > access. The ioctl is invoked using the VFIO mediated matrix > device's file descriptor. > > Guest access to AP adapters, usage domains and control domains > is controlled by three bit masks referenced from the > guest's SIE state description: The AP Mask (APM) controls > access to the AP adapters; the AP Queue Mask (AQM) controls > access to the AP usage domains; and the AP Domain Mask (ADM) > controls access to the AP control domains. Each bit > in the APM represents an adapter, from left to right, > starting with adapter 0. Each bit in the AQM represents > a usage domain, from left to right, starting with domain 0. > Each bit in the ADM represents a control domain, from left > to right, starting with domain 0. > > The APM, AQM and ADM bit masks will be populated from the > bit masks stored in the corresponding mediated matrix device's > sysfs files.
